What does Robbyn mean and where does it come from?
Robbyn is a contemporary variant of the name 'Robin', itself a diminutive of 'Robert'. The feminine spelling typically denotes a more modern appeal. The story of Robbyn
Robbyn entered American naming records in 1947 and has been in use for over 77 years. With 1,066 total births recorded, Robbyn remains relatively uncommon. Once ranked #2405 in 1955, the name has become less common in recent years, sitting at #13445 in 2000.
